I kind of doubt this function of the fan. The Falcon was initially called Sparrow and had an 68000 instead of an 68030. I don't know wether the Sparrow had a fan but if it had, it surely wasn't there to cool the 68000 but rather the DSP.
Expansion cards like FalconSpeed (486SX card) have fit onto the expansion port which is above the CPU, so the fan reaches this part about as much as the CPU itself.
About the speed of the CPU in the TT: Yes, it runs at twice the speed but then again, it is made for 32 MHz. The 68030 in the Falcon is, despite all rumours, an 68030 made to run at 16 MHz after all.
Therefore i still recommend to not completely disable the fan but silence it by putting a resistor on it.
